Mark,
<br><br>Thanks for your feedback and review of the proposed solution and raising of
<br>the issues. Much appreciated.
<br><br>The problem I am trying to address is a specific one which I then tried to
<br>make generic enough to fit in with the Drools core. My specific issue is
<br>that the system I am working with has a custom spreadsheet compiler that
<br>generates a number of rule files. I am only interested in regenerating the
<br>rule files when the spreadsheet gets changed. I assume it would be best to
<br>update the custom spreadsheet compilation to return a changeset once the
<br>rule files have been generated - thus allowing me to add them as you
<br>propose.
<br><br>I assume I can achieve this with your proposed updates to the solution I
<br>have been working on. It is my intention to provide code that not only
<br>functions as expected but fits in with the Drools team architecture
<br>direction. I shall update in accordance with your proposal if you think
<br>this will still fit my solution and provide a generic solution for user
<br>resources.
<br><br>Peter Sellars
<br><br><br>&quot;Mark Proctor [via Drools - Java Rules Engine]&quot; &lt;ml-node
<br>+<a href="http://n3.nabble.com/user/SendEmail.jtp?type=node&node=202323&i=0" target="_top" rel="nofollow">[hidden email]</a>&gt; wrote on 11/02/2010 05:00:34 p.m.:
<br><div class='shrinkable-quote'><br>&gt; [image removed]
<br>&gt;
<br>&gt; Re: Drools VSM Module - Build Issue
<br>&gt;
<br>&gt; Mark Proctor [via Drools - Java Rules Engine]
<br>&gt;
<br>&gt; to:
<br>&gt;
<br>&gt; petersellars
<br>&gt;
<br>&gt; 11/02/2010 05:00 p.m.
<br>&gt;
<br>&gt; Last hudson was fiinally blue:
<br>&gt; <a href="https://hudson.jboss.org/hudson/job/drools/" target="_top" rel="nofollow" link="external">https://hudson.jboss.org/hudson/job/drools/</a><br>&gt;
<br>&gt; Btw I did reveiw your initial proposal, there where some things I think
<br>&gt; will need to be addressed. Particularly the idea of the Resource
<br>&gt; returning multiple resources, it seems a little dirty. I think instead
<br>&gt; i'd prefer that the Resource returns a changeset that lists those
<br>&gt; multiple resources. We should probably add a ResourceConfiguration that
<br>&gt; allows the handler to be provided for handling the resources. Anything
<br>&gt; that deals with a Resources mapping to multiple Resources needs to fit
<br>&gt; in with the definition's mapping, which is url based, for the
<br>&gt; KnowledgeAgent, and will need full test coverage that it doens't break
<br>&gt; anything in the KnowlegeAgent definitions to url mapping and rebuilding.
<br>&gt;
<br>&gt; Mark
<br>&gt;
<br>&gt;
<br>&gt; On 11/02/2010 03:09, Peter Sellars wrote:
<br>&gt;
<br>&gt; &gt; Am trying to build drools in order to test a patch for user resources
</div>but
<br>&gt; &gt; have an issue with drools-vsm module.
<br>&gt; &gt;
<br>&gt; &gt; I have added a method to the KnowledgeBuilderFactoryService interface.
<br>The
<br>&gt; &gt; clients in the VSM complain that they do not override the method.
<br>&gt; &gt;
<br>&gt; &gt; I am sure there is a simple step I am missing that will fix this issue
<br>(it
<br>&gt; &gt; appears my snapshot version of the api, core and compiler modules are
<br>not
<div class='shrinkable-quote'><br>&gt; &gt; being used by vsm).
<br>&gt; &gt;
<br>&gt; &gt; Any ideas?
<br>&gt; &gt;
<br>&gt; &gt; Peter Sellars
<br>&gt; &gt;
<br>&gt; &gt;
<br>&gt; &gt;
<br>&gt; &gt; Attention:
<br>&gt; &gt; This email may contain information intended for the sole use of
<br>&gt; &gt; the original recipient. Please respect this when sharing or
<br>&gt; &gt; disclosing this email's contents with any third party. If you
<br>&gt; &gt; believe you have received this email in error, please delete it
<br>&gt; &gt; and notify the sender or [hidden email] as
<br>&gt; &gt; soon as possible. The content of this email does not necessarily
<br>&gt; &gt; reflect the views of Solnet Solutions Ltd.
<br>&gt; &gt;
<br>&gt; &gt; _______________________________________________
<br>&gt; &gt; rules-dev mailing list
<br>&gt; &gt; [hidden email]
<br>&gt; &gt; <a href="https://lists.jboss.org/mailman/listinfo/rules-dev" target="_top" rel="nofollow" link="external">https://lists.jboss.org/mailman/listinfo/rules-dev</a><br>&gt; &gt;
<br>&gt; &gt;
<br>&gt;
<br>&gt; _______________________________________________
<br>&gt; rules-dev mailing list
<br>&gt; [hidden email]
<br>&gt; <a href="https://lists.jboss.org/mailman/listinfo/rules-dev" target="_top" rel="nofollow" link="external">https://lists.jboss.org/mailman/listinfo/rules-dev</a><br>&gt;
</div><br>&gt; View message @ <a href="http://n3.nabble.com/Drools-VSM-Module-Build-Issue-" target="_top" rel="nofollow" link="external">http://n3.nabble.com/Drools-VSM-Module-Build-Issue-</a><br>&gt; tp199452p199482.html
<br>&gt; To start a new topic under Drools - Dev, email ml-node
<br>&gt; +<a href="http://n3.nabble.com/user/SendEmail.jtp?type=node&node=202323&i=1" target="_top" rel="nofollow">[hidden email]</a>
<br>&gt; To unsubscribe from Drools - Dev, click here.
<br><br><br><br>Attention:
<br>This email may contain information intended for the sole use of
<br>the original recipient. Please respect this when sharing or
<br>disclosing this email's contents with any third party. If you
<br>believe you have received this email in error, please delete it
<br>and notify the sender or <a href="http://n3.nabble.com/user/SendEmail.jtp?type=node&node=202323&i=2" target="_top" rel="nofollow">[hidden email]</a> as
<br>soon as possible. The content of this email does not necessarily
<br>reflect the views of Solnet Solutions Ltd.
<br><br>
<br><hr align="left" width="300">
View this message in context: <a href="http://n3.nabble.com/Drools-VSM-Module-Build-Issue-tp199452p202323.html">Re: Drools VSM Module - Build Issue</a><br>
Sent from the <a href="http://n3.nabble.com/Drools-Dev-f62260.html">Drools - Dev mailing list archive</a> at Nabble.com.<br>